💻 Online Renewal Process

Online Renewal Process — The Texas DPS offers an online renewal system for driver licenses, which can be accessed through the Texas Department of Public Safety website. To renew online, you'll need to create an account and provide the required documents and information, including your driver license number, date of birth, and social security number, as specified by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ration. You'll also need to pay the renewal fee using a credit or debit card, as required by the Texas Department of Public Safety. Once you've completed the online application, you'll receive a confirmation email with instructions on how to print your temporary driver license.

📨 Mail-in Renewal Process

Mail-in Renewal Process — If you're unable to renew online, you can also renew your driver license by mail. To do so, you'll need to complete the renewal application form, which can be downloaded from the Texas Department of Public Safety website, and provide the required documents and information, including proof of identity, residency, and citizenship, as required by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ration. You'll also need to include a check or money order for the renewal fee. Mail the application and supporting documents to the address listed on the form.

📍 In-Person Renewal Process

In-Person Renewal Process — If you prefer to renew your driver license in person, you can visit the local DPS office in Frisco, Texas. Be sure to bring all the required documents and information, including proof of identity, residency, and citizenship, as required by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ration. You'll also need to pay the renewal fee using a credit or debit card, cash, or check, as required by the Texas Department of Public Safety.
